Введение в Visual Basic Editor в Excel
Excel — это мощный инструмент для обработки данных, анализа и визуализации информации. Однако его функционал можно значительно расширить с помощью **visual basic editor excel**. Этот инструмент позволяет пользователям писать макросы и автоматизировать задачи, делая рабочий процесс более эффективным. В данной статье мы подробно рассмотрим, что такое редактор Visual Basic, как им пользоваться и какие возможности он открывает.
Что такое Visual Basic Editor?
Visual Basic Editor (VBE) — это встроенный компонент в Microsoft Excel, который помогает пользователям создавать макросы с использованием языка программирования Visual Basic for Applications (VBA). С помощью VBE можно проводить программирование, создавать пользовательские функции и автоматизировать рутинные задачи. Это особенно полезно для профессионалов, работающих с большими объемами данных.
Как открыть Visual Basic Editor?
Чтобы открыть **visual basic editor excel**, выполните следующие действия:
- Запустите Microsoft Excel.
- Перейдите на вкладку «Разработчик» (если она не отображается, ее нужно активировать через параметры Excel).
- Нажмите на кнопку «Visual Basic».
Теперь перед вами откроется окно редактора, где вы сможете писать и редактировать код на VBA.
Основные компоненты Visual Basic Editor
Интерфейс VBE состоит из нескольких ключевых элементов:
- Область проекта: здесь отображаются все открытые рабочие книги и их объекты.
- Редактор кода: здесь вы пишете и редактируете ваш VBA-код.
- Окно свойств: используется для отображения и редактирования свойств различных объектов.
Создание макроса в Visual Basic Editor
Создание макроса в **visual basic editor excel** требует выполнения следующих шагов:
- В открытом VBE выберите «Insert» в верхнем меню и нажмите «Module». Это создаст новый модуль.
- В редакторе кода введите ваш VBA-код. Например:
Sub HelloWorld() MsgBox "Hello, World!" End Sub
- Закройте VBE и вернитесь в Excel.
- Запустите макрос через «Разработчик» — «Макросы».
После выполнения этих шагов появится сообщение с текстом «Hello, World!», что подтвердит, что вы успешно создали и запустили макрос.
Типы макросов и их применение
В **visual basic editor excel** можно создавать разные типы макросов для различных задач:
- Автоматизация расчетов: вы можете создать макрос, который будет выполнять сложные вычисления по нажатию кнопки.
- Форматирование данных: макрос может автоматически форматировать выделенные ячейки, изменяя шрифт, цвет и стиль.
- Импорт и экспорт данных: с помощью макросов можно легко импортировать данные из внешних источников в Excel.
Переход на следующий уровень: пользовательские функции
С помощью **visual basic editor excel** вы также можете создавать собственные функции, которые не доступны в стандартной версии Excel. Например, вы можете написать функцию, которая будет выполнять сложные операции с данными и возвращать результат непосредственно в ячейку Excel. Чтобы создать пользовательскую функцию, нужно использовать следующую структуру:
Function MyFunction(arg1 As DataType, arg2 As DataType) As DataType ' Ваш код здесь End Function
Заключение
visual basic editor excel предоставляет пользователям мощную возможность для автоматизации и расширения функционала Excel. С помощью VBE можно создавать макросы, пользовательские функции и автоматизировать рутинные задачи, значительно повышая продуктивность работы. Если вы еще не начали использовать VBE, пришло время изучить этот мощный инструмент и внедрить его в свой рабочий процесс!